Pushbutton switches have been in use for many years in the industrial, medical, and military markets. In recent years, many automatic pushbutton switches (TA2UEEAAGPN) have been developed to allow easier access to switching functions. Today, TA2UEEAAGPN switches are commonly used in a variety of applications, from machine control and operating systems in industrial environments to medical equipment control in hospitals and clinics.
TA2UEEAAGPN switches are designed for easy operation, with a wide range of customizable configurations. There are two main types of TA2UEEAAGPN switches: momentary and latching. Momentary TA2UEEAAGPN switches have a single action, meaning the switch is activated when pressed and released when the button is released. On the other hand, latching TA2UEEAAGPN switches retain their position even after the button is released.
The basic components of TA2UEEAAGPN switches include a contact plate, a lever, a contact plate holder, and a button. The contact plate is mounted in the contact plate holder and is held in place by a lever. As the lever is actuated, the contact plate is pushed against the contact plate holder, and when the lever is in the non-position, the contact plate is allowed to return to its rest position. As a result of these movements, the contact plate either creates a circuit or breaks an existing circuit.
The TA2UEEAAGPN switch is designed to be reliable, it can be utilized in a wide range of applications including industrial control systems, automotive and machine control systems, medical equipment control, electrical appliances control, and electronic test equipment. Further, the different configurations of TA2UEEAAGPN switches make them suitable for a variety of applications. For instance, a TA2UEEAAGPN momentary switch can be used for alerting signals, while a latching one can be used to control a motor. There are a number of options that can be customized to meet the specific requirements of the user’s application. These include the dimensions of the button and the contact plate, the actuation force, the number of gang contacts, the wiring schemes, and the maximum operating temperature.
The working principle of TA2UEEAAGPN switches is based on the concept of electrical continuity between two electrical points. When the TA2UEEAAGPN switch is actuated, the lever moves to close the contact plate. This physically creates an electrical connection between the two points, allowing current to flow through the circuit. When the switch is released the contact plate moves back to its resting position, interrupting the connection and breaking the flow of current.
